Note di degustazione
(aged for eight months in 70% stainless steel tanks and 30% in wooden barrels): Bright yellow. Spicy orchard fruits and pit fruits on the deeply scented nose and in the mouth. Fleshy and broad, developing a floral nuance as the wine opens up. Melon and white peach notes linger on a long, subtly smoky finish that shows very good energy and focus.

The 2013 Chateauneuf du Pape Blanc has gorgeous tangerine, quince, honeysuckle, white flower and buttered-citrus notes in its full, fleshy, ripe and mineral-laced character. Clean and vibrant, with both richness and freshness, give it another year or so and enjoy bottles over the following couple of decades.

This Châteauneuf-du-Pape estate is one of the Rhône’s most famous addresses. With a history stretching back to the 16th century, Beaucastel remains family owned and run, with the fifth generation of the Perrin family – Marc, Pierre, Thomas, Cécile, Charles, Matthieu and César – at the helm today.
